"use strict";(self.webpackChunk_N_E=self.webpackChunk_N_E||[]).push([[8148],{32457:(e,t,r)=>{r.d(t,{G:()=>a});var n=r(89925),i=r(68825);let o=e=>(i.A.ready(e),()=>{}),a=()=>(0,n.useSyncExternalStore)(o,()=>!!i.A.isInitialized(),()=>!1)},55868:(e,t,r)=>{r.d(t,{ExperimentProvider:()=>m,G:()=>b});var n=r(66881),i=r(89925),o=r(64365),a=r(91649),l=r(69009),s=r(20895),d=r(68825),u=r(57934),c=r(32457),f=r(21453),p=r(37811);let g="client-a74nh7wdmymfO9eOcl5awe1cgB30BDRV",v="production"!==p.env.VERCEL_TARGET_ENV,x=(0,i.createContext)(null),m=e=>{let{children:t}=e,r=(0,s.md)(l.pX),p=function(e){let t=(0,i.useRef)(null),[r,n]=(0,i.useState)(!1);return(0,i.useEffect)(()=>{if(a.A&&!r&&g)try{t.current=o.aj.initialize(g,{debug:v,fetchTimeoutMillis:5e3,retryFetchOnFailure:!0,fetchOnStart:!1,exposureTrackingProvider:{track:t=>{try{console.debug("[Experiment] Raw Exposure:",t),e(t),console.debug("[Experiment] Exposure tracked:",t)}catch(e){console.error("[Experiment] Failed to track exposure:",e)}}}}),n(!0),console.debug("Amplitude Experiment SDK initialized")}catch(e){console.error("Failed to initialize Amplitude Experiment SDK:",e)}},[r,e]),t.current}((()=>{let e=(0,f.q)(),t=(0,u.N)({effectiveLocation:e}),r=(0,c.G)();return(0,i.useCallback)(function(e){let n=arguments.length>1&&void 0!==arguments[1]?arguments[1]:{};if(!r)return void console.warn("MParticle is not initialized");if(!e)return void console.warn("No exposure data provided to trackEnrolledInExperiment");try{let r={...t,newVariant:e.variant||"",newExperiment:e.experiment_key||"",newExperimentReceivedAt:Date.now()};d.A.logEvent("enrolled-in-experiment",d.A.EventType.Other,r,n),console.debug("MParticle: Event tracked - enrolled-in-experiment for ".concat(e.flag_key||"unknown",":").concat(e.variant))}catch(e){console.error("MParticle: Failed to track event",e)}},[r,t])})());return(0,i.useEffect)(()=>{(async()=>{if(p&&r){let e={device_id:r,user_properties:{}};console.debug("[Experiment] Fetching experiments for user:",e),await p.fetch(e)}})()},[p,r]),(0,n.jsx)(x.Provider,{value:{client:p,variant:(e,t)=>{if(!p)return t;let r=p.variant(e,t);return console.debug("[Experiment] Current Variant:",r),r},fetch:e=>p?p.fetch(e):Promise.resolve()},children:t})},b=()=>{let e=(0,i.useContext)(x);if(!e)throw Error("useExperimentContext must be used within an AmplitudeExperimentProvider");return e}},59864:(e,t,r)=>{r.d(t,{p:()=>o});var n=r(66881);r(89925);var i=r(51310);function o(e){let{className:t,type:r,...o}=e;return(0,n.jsx)("input",{type:r,"data-slot":"input",className:(0,i.cn)("file:text-foreground placeholder:text-muted-foreground selection:bg-primary selection:text-primary-foreground dark:bg-input/30 border-input shadow-xs flex h-9 w-full min-w-0 rounded-md border bg-transparent px-3 py-1 text-base outline-none transition-[color,box-shadow] file:inline-flex file:h-7 file:border-0 file:bg-transparent file:text-sm file:font-medium disabled:pointer-events-none disabled:cursor-not-allowed disabled:opacity-50 md:text-sm","focus-visible:border-ring focus-visible:ring-ring/50 focus-visible:ring-[3px]","aria-invalid:ring-destructive/20 dark:aria-invalid:ring-destructive/40 aria-invalid:border-destructive",t),...o})}},61005:(e,t,r)=>{r.d(t,{AM:()=>s,Rp:()=>u,Wv:()=>d,hl:()=>c});var n=r(66881),i=r(89925),o=r(85418),a=r(51310);let l=i.createContext({trigger:"click",onMouseEnter:()=>{},onMouseLeave:()=>{}});function s(e){let{trigger:t="click",openDelay:r=0,closeDelay:a=300,open:s,onOpenChange:d,...u}=e,[c,f]=i.useState(s||!1),p=i.useRef(null),g=i.useRef(null);i.useEffect(()=>{void 0!==s&&f(s)},[s]);let v=i.useCallback(e=>{f(e),null==d||d(e)},[d]);i.useEffect(()=>()=>{p.current&&clearTimeout(p.current),g.current&&clearTimeout(g.current)},[]);let x=i.useCallback(()=>{"hover"===t&&(g.current&&(clearTimeout(g.current),g.current=null),c||(p.current=setTimeout(()=>{v(!0)},r)))},[t,c,r,v]),m=i.useCallback(()=>{"hover"===t&&(p.current&&(clearTimeout(p.current),p.current=null),g.current=setTimeout(()=>{v(!1)},a))},[t,a,v]),b=i.useMemo(()=>({trigger:t,onMouseEnter:x,onMouseLeave:m}),[t,x,m]);return(0,n.jsx)(l.Provider,{value:b,children:(0,n.jsx)(o.bL,{"data-slot":"popover",open:c,onOpenChange:v,...u})})}function d(e){let{...t}=e,{trigger:r,onMouseEnter:a,onMouseLeave:s}=i.useContext(l);return(0,n.jsx)(o.l9,{"data-slot":"popover-trigger",..."hover"===r?{onMouseEnter:a,onMouseLeave:s}:{},...t})}function u(e){let{...t}=e;return(0,n.jsx)(o.i3,{"data-slot":"popover-arrow",...t})}function c(e){let{className:t,align:r="center",sideOffset:s=4,children:d,showArrow:u=!0,...c}=e,{trigger:f,onMouseEnter:p,onMouseLeave:g}=i.useContext(l);return(0,n.jsx)(o.ZL,{children:(0,n.jsxs)(o.UC,{"data-slot":"popover-content",align:r,sideOffset:s,className:(0,a.cn)("bg-popover text-popover-foreground data-[state=open]:animate-in data-[state=closed]:animate-out data-[state=closed]:fade-out-0 data-[state=open]:fade-in-0 data-[state=closed]:zoom-out-95 data-[state=open]:zoom-in-95 data-[side=bottom]:slide-in-from-top-2 data-[side=left]:slide-in-from-right-2 data-[side=right]:slide-in-from-left-2 data-[side=top]:slide-in-from-bottom-2 origin-(--radix-popover-content-transform-origin) outline-hidden z-50 w-72 rounded-md border-none p-4 shadow-[0_2px_12px_0_#0003]",t),..."hover"===f?{onMouseEnter:p,onMouseLeave:g}:{},...c,children:[u&&(0,n.jsx)(o.i3,{className:"border-none fill-white",height:12,width:20}),d]})})}},70526:(e,t,r)=>{r.d(t,{$n:()=>f});var n=r(66881),i=r(89925),o=r(79145),a=r(60823),l=r(51310),s=r(28319);let d=(0,i.forwardRef)((e,t)=>{let{title:r,titleId:i,desc:o,descId:a,...l}=e;return(0,n.jsxs)("svg",{xmlns:"http://www.w3.org/2000/svg",fill:"none",viewBox:"0 0 16 16",ref:t,"aria-labelledby":i,"aria-describedby":a,...l,children:[o?(0,n.jsx)("desc",{id:a,children:o}):null,void 0===r?(0,n.jsx)("title",{id:i,children:"Loader Circle"}):r?(0,n.jsx)("title",{id:i,children:r}):null,(0,n.jsx)("path",{fill:"currentColor",fillRule:"evenodd",d:"M9.65 2.926A5.335 5.335 0 1 0 13.335 8a.665.665 0 0 1 1.33 0 6.665 6.665 0 1 1-4.606-6.34.665.665 0 1 1-.41 1.266",clipRule:"evenodd"})]})}),u=i.forwardRef((e,t)=>(0,n.jsx)(s.h,{ref:t,icon:d,...e}));u.displayName="LoaderCircle";let c=(0,a.F)("rounded-lg cursor-pointer",{variants:{variant:{default:"bg-brand-400 text-primary-foreground hover:bg-[#252C3F] active:bg-[#0C1226] focus:outline-none focus:ring-2 focus:ring-blue-500 focus:ring-offset-0",secondary:"bg-white text-gray-900 active:bg-[#E6E6E6] focus:outline-none focus:ring-1 focus:ring-blue-500 focus:ring-offset-0",destructive:"bg-alert-severe hover:bg-[#C1251A] active:bg-[#A70C00] text-white focus:outline-none focus:ring-1 focus:ring-blue-500 focus:ring-offset-0",outline:"border-1 border-gray-500 hover:bg-white active:bg-[#E6E6E6] bg-transparent focus:outline-none focus:ring-1 focus:ring-blue-500 focus:ring-offset-0",ghost:"hover:bg-white active:bg-[#E6E6E6] bg-transparent focus:outline-none focus:ring-1 focus:ring-blue-500 focus:ring-offset-0",link:"text-primary underline-offset-3 underline focus:outline-none focus:ring-1 focus:ring-blue-500 focus:ring-offset-0",avatarAccountLink:"text-primary text-[14px]",avatarGoPremium:"bg-gray-900 text-white text-[14px]",avatarSignOut:"text-primary text-[16px]",ghostUI:""},size:{default:"h-10 px-4 py-3",lg:"h-10 px-8 py-3",sm:"h-8 px-3 py-2",xsm:"h-6 px-2",icon:"h-10 w-10",text:""},loading:{true:"pointer-events-none cursor-not-allowed opacity-50",false:""},disabled:{true:"pointer-events-none cursor-not-allowed opacity-30",false:""}},defaultVariants:{variant:"default",size:"default",loading:!1,disabled:!1}}),f=i.forwardRef((e,t)=>{let{className:r,role:i,type:a,variant:s="default",size:d,asChild:f=!1,disabled:p=!1,loading:g=!1,children:v,style:x,onClick:m,onFocus:b,onMouseEnter:h,onMouseLeave:w,"data-testid":E,"data-slot":y,"data-state":k,"aria-label":C,"aria-controls":j,"aria-expanded":A,"aria-haspopup":S}=e,R=f?o.DX:"button";return(0,n.jsxs)(R,{onClick:m,onFocus:b,onMouseEnter:h,onMouseLeave:w,"data-testid":E,"data-slot":y,"data-state":k,"aria-label":C,"aria-controls":j,"aria-expanded":A,"aria-haspopup":S,role:i,type:a,style:x,className:(0,l.cn)(c({variant:s,size:d,loading:g,disabled:p,className:r}),"flex items-center justify-center"),ref:t,disabled:p||g,children:[g&&(0,n.jsx)(u,{size:"sm",className:"mr-2 animate-spin",color:"default"===s||"destructive"===s?"inverse":"primary"}),v]})});f.displayName="Button"},81312:(e,t,r)=>{r.d(t,{A:()=>a,d:()=>o});var n=r(89925),i=r(66508);function o(e,t){let[r,o]=(0,n.useState)(e);return(0,n.useEffect)(()=>{let r=(0,i.s)(e=>{o(e)},t);return r(e),()=>{r.cancel()}},[e,t]),r}let a=o},84378:(e,t,r)=>{r.d(t,{W:()=>l,default:()=>d});var n=r(66881),i=r(55180),o=r(36312),a=r(28987);let l=(0,a.eU)(!1);function s(){if(window.top===window.self)window.DprSdk&&(window.DprSdk.init({getApplicationInfo:()=>({id:"weather.com",version:"2.0.0"}),getUserRegime:()=>(0,o.getCookie)("twc-privacy")}),(0,a.zp)().set(l,!0));else try{var e;(null==(e=window.top)?void 0:e.DprSdk)&&(window.DprSdk=window.top.DprSdk)}catch(e){}}function d(){return(0,n.jsx)(i.default,{async:!0,src:"https://weather.com/api/v1/script/dprSdkScript.js",onLoad:s})}}}]);